The goal if this presentation is to (a) discuss the core behavioral model of sleep, (b) describe a functional behavior assessment process for sleep problems in children diagnosed with ASD, (c) identify current evidence-based interventions for sleep problems associated with ASD, and (d) discuss strategies for designing personalized, comprehensive, socially acceptable sleep interventions and prevention strategies. Research has repeatedly shown that children who are later diagnosed with autism use fewer gestures to point things out to others (i.e., show and share) and to request things from others (i.e., mand). Profound autism is a relatively new term not yet adopted by most clinicians and researchers nor defined by diagnostic manuals or tools; however, it is a term that is being used to describe individuals with autism who require 24-hour support throughout their lives.
